There is No test–retest reliability of brain activation induced by robotic passive hand movement: A functional NIRS study
Abstract Introduction The basic paradigm of rehabilitation is based on the brain plasticity, and for promoting it, test–retest reliability (TRR) of brain activation in which certain area of the brain is repeatedly activated is required.
